NDC Primaries: Ballot boxes destroyed by thugs at Suame

Voting at the Suame MA JHS was disrupted when a group of unknown thugs destroyed some of the ballot boxes.

A swift intervention by the police, however, prevented a possible clash between supporters of the two candidates.

The chaotic situation brought the entire exercise to a temporary halt.

The electoral officers were helpless as tempers flared with heated verbal exchanges.

Francis Dodovi, one of the aspirants in the Suame constituency, accused his opponent Brogya Gyamfi of infiltrating the voters’ register with foreign names.

Gyamfi was, however, not reachable for a reaction.

Chief Inspector Daniel Lomotey, who leads the police team, said the perpetrators are being pursued while a review of security arrangement at the polling station has been carried out.

Officers of the Electoral Commission have assured voters of replacing the destroyed boxes.
